NEWS Merthyr Town FC < Back News (News-Item) FA Cup Preview | Merthyr Town vs. Taunton Town 15 September 2023 Merthyr Town continue their Emirates FA Cup campaign against National League South side Taunton Town on Friday Night (7.45pm). The Martyrs face the Peacocks in an enthralling encounter as both sides aim to reach their First Round heights achieved last season. OPPOSITION FOCUS | IN THE DUGOUT Rob Dray joined the club in the summer of 2016, being appointed to the backroom team as coach. He has a wealth of experience in the non-league game, originally being a player and manager of Bridgwater Town Reserves in the Somerset County League. He stepped up to manage Bridgwater Town’s first team at the start of the 2010-11 season but a poor run of results saw his departure from Fairfax Park in March 2012 before he became assistant manager to Sean Joyce at Southern Premier new boys Bideford in the summer of that year. After three seasons in North Devon, he left to have a short spell at Yate Town in 2015 but took a break from the game for the majority of the 2015-16 season. Upon joining the Peacocks, he became part of the successful management team that guided the team to the FA Cup 1st Round Proper and the Southern League West Division title in consecutive seasons. He then assumed the role of interim manager in September 2018 following the departure of Leigh Robinson before being appointed Head of Football a month later, leading the Peacocks to a tremendous second-place finish in their first-ever season at Southern Premier level. After two seasons curtailed due to Covid, he achieved his finest moment when guiding the Peacocks to the Southern Premier South title in 2021, a feat which earned promotion to the National League South for the first time in the club’s history. Despite a crippling injury list, he steered the club to a highly respectable 14th place finish in their debut season. OPPOSITION FOCUS | SEASON SO FAR The Peacocks have enjoyed a strong start to the National League South season winning five of their opening nine league games. Goals from Nick Grimes and Ross Stearn guided Dray’s side to an opening-day win against Braintree Town on 5 August. Since then the Peacocks have gained wins against Welling United, ST Albans and most recently Tonbridge Angels. The away side currently sit fifth in the league table on 14 points having scored 16 goals so far. OPPOSITION FOCUS | KEY PLAYER Ross Stearn is a vastly experienced goalscoring midfielder who joined the Peacocks in November 2021 after being released from Chippenham Town due to financial constraints. He began his career at Bristol City before leaving to join Forest Green Rovers in the summer of 2009 for a brief spell. He then signed for Weston-super-Mare in September 2009 until switching to Almondsbury Town at the start of 2010. A move to Chippenham Town followed in the summer of 2011 and Stearn then spent the following season back at Weston-super-Mare. He then signed for Bath City ahead of the 2013-14 season, spending two years at Twerton Park where he registered 28 goals, before linking up with National League South side Sutton United in the summer of 2015 where he helped them win promotion. Ross then departed to join Eastleigh in November 2016 for a year until returning to Sutton towards the end of 2017. He spent a loan period at Bath City in the early part of 2018 before signing permanently for City again in the 2018 close season, enjoying another two seasons with Bath until joining Chippenham in the summer of 2020. He finished as the club’s second-highest goalscorer in 2022-23 which included the first ever Peacocks’ hat trick in the National League. FORM GUIDE Merthyr Town - W W W W W L Taunton Town - W W D W D W PAST MEETING | MARTYRS vs. PEACOCKS A memorable fixture for the Martyrs against Taunton Town came back in February 2020 at Penydarren Park, when a stunning hat-trick from Eliot Richards along with an Ian Traylor strike saw the Martyrs claim a 4-2 victory against the Peacocks in the Southern League Premier South. NEWS Merthyr Town FC < Back News (News-Title) Jay Williams signs! 29 August 2024 Merthyr Town Football Club are delighted to announce the signing of defender, Jay Williams from National League side, Sutton United, on loan until 7th January 2025. Jay, who is a Merthyr boy, and son of former Merthyr Town player and manager, Gavin Williams, came through the academy system at Newport County before joining Fulham in the summer of 2019 as a 16-year-old. Jay, who is a centre-back and also comfortable at full-back, spent just over four years with the Premier League side featuring over 50 times for their U18s and U21s and played a key role in their Premier League Cup winning campaign, before signing for then League Two side, Sutton United in January 2024. Jay has also been capped 13 times at U16 through to U21 level for Wales, last featuring in the UEFA Under-21 European Championship Qualifiers in October 2023. Speaking on securing the loan deal for Jay, Paul Michael said, “Jay’s a supremely talented player, a local boy and someone who already knows a few of our current players from Wales age-grade squads, and Newport County, so I have no doubt he will settle in very quickly. It is a fantastic signing for us, with Jay having played so many games in the Premier League 2 competition for Fulham, and we are delighted to give Jay another platform in senior football, and I am sure he’ll help us achieve our goals over at least the first half of the season. Thank you to Jay and Sutton United for trusting us with the next small part of his development.” Jay’s loan transfer will be subject to FAW and FA approval, and we would like to thank Sutton United for their assistance throughout the transfer. NEWS Merthyr Town FC < Back News (News-Title) Green Flag flying at Merthyr Town Football Club 18 July 2023 Environmental charity Keep Wales Tidy has unveiled this year’s Green Flag Award winners – the international mark of a quality park or green space. We are delighted to announce that our Remembrance and Well-Being garden has achieved the coveted Green Flag Community Award in recognition of its high environmental standards, cleanliness, safety and community involvement. Originally the location for the garden was overgrown and unused, it has improved the visual and aesthetic nature of this piece of land, that is now used as a place for reflection as well as remembrance. The land is in an elevated position and provides spectacular views of the surrounding mountainside and neighbourhoods. The project includes pathways, benches, planting, shrubs, bird and bat boxes, wild flowers, a water feature and is supported by a number of other community organisations. We would also like to thank the local contractors who were involved in the project. Our Club Chaplain, David Powell said “This award provides signifiant recognition for all of the hard work carried out by our dedicated group of volunteers. We hope that the presence of the garden in our urban landscape will provide a green space for members of the local community to reflect and enjoy being in a well maintained, local open space.” 180 community managed green spaces across the country have met the high standards needed to receive the Green Flag Community Award. Now in its third decade, Green Flag recognises well-managed parks and green spaces in 20 countries around the world. In Wales, the awards scheme is run by Keep Wales Tidy. Lucy Prisk, Green Flag Coordinator for Keep Wales Tidy said “Free access to safe, high quality green space has never been more important. Our award-winning sites play a vital role in people’s mental and physical well-being, providing a haven for communities to come together, relax and enjoy nature. News that a record number of community managed green spaces in Wales have achieved Green Flag status is testament to the dedication and hard work of hundreds of volunteers.
